Casey Bralla on 22 Nov 2015 09:52:29 -0800


[Date Prev] [Date Next] [Thread Prev] [Thread Next] [Date Index] [Thread Index]

[PLUG] Solved: Need to Convert HTML Page to jpg Image


Well, as usual, another 15 minutes of searching found a solution.    

If "html2ps" is installed, imagemagick's "convert" can do this easily.

Convert page.html page.jpg


Casey




On Sunday, November 22, 2015 12:29:20 PM Casey Bralla wrote:
> Good questions, Steve.
> 
> 
> I want a simple screen-shot of the first page.  I'll shrink this down to
> about 20% of full size and display it next to a pull-down list of uploaded
> pages. This way the user will have both a saved name, and simple visual
> image of the page they uploaded.
> 
> The user won't have to actually read the details of the page;  he'll just be
> able to recognize it so he can remember what is on it.
> 
> On Sunday, November 22, 2015 12:13:03 PM Steve Litt wrote:
> > On Sun, 22 Nov 2015 11:58:33 -0500
> > 
> > Casey Bralla <MailList@nerdworld.org> wrote:
> > > I'm writing a web application where users will upload an HTML page
> > > which will be shown on another page.   I want to allow the user to
> > > see a miniature image of the HTML file they uploaded.
> > > 
> > > Anybody know how to convert an HTML page into a jpg or png file?
> > > I've seen online tools to do this, but I need to have my application
> > > automatically convert them on the fly (ie: I need a cli program to
> > > convert HTML into a png or jpg.)
> > 
> > I think you need to define your requirements more tightly. Do you want
> > the .png to include every single word of a 500K word web page? A sort
> > of 8.5" x 3000" .png? Or do you want the .png to be what the viewer sees
> > in the browser after the HTML file has been loaded but before any
> > scrolling or navigation has taken place? Do you need just the raw text,
> > or do you need the appearance and fonts too? Do you want the containing
> > browser to be part of the image (a screenshot, in other words)?
> > 
> > SteveT
> > 
> > Steve Litt
> > November 2015 featured book: Troubleshooting Techniques
> > 
> >      of the Successful Technologist
> > 
> > http://www.troubleshooters.com/techniques
> > __________________________________________________________________________
> > _
> > Philadelphia Linux Users Group         --       
> > http://www.phillylinux.org
> > Announcements -
> > http://lists.phillylinux.org/mailman/listinfo/plug-announce
> > General Discussion  --  
> > http://lists.phillylinux.org/mailman/listinfo/plug

-- 

Casey Bralla

Chief Nerd in Residence
The NerdWorld Organisation
www.NerdWorld.org
___________________________________________________________________________
Philadelphia Linux Users Group         --        http://www.phillylinux.org
Announcements - http://lists.phillylinux.org/mailman/listinfo/plug-announce
General Discussion  --   http://lists.phillylinux.org/mailman/listinfo/plug